U+2138 "ℸ" Dalet Symbol is a typographic and scientific notation glyph representing the fourth letter of the Hebrew alphabet, dalet, used in contexts such as mathematics and logic as a symbol for the fourth element in a set or sequence. It is part of the Letterlike Symbols block in Unicode, designed to distinguish it from regular alphabetical characters for specialized uses, including in some forms of symbolic logic or as a notation in Talmudic and Kabbalistic references. The symbol carries the same sound value as the English "d" and maintains a visual connection to its Hebrew script origin, with a distinctive angular shape featuring a diagonal stroke.
